以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  [求助]列名和1~3行不见了,如果找回来?  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=82958)

--  作者:四月清风
--  发布时间:2016/3/28 22:01:00
--  [求助]列名和1~3行不见了,如果找回来?
别的表都是好好的,只有一个表异常,是哪里的问题呢?

我设定了一个主窗口,然后打开主窗口,还是异常的(感觉开没开主窗口效果都是一样的,没有变化),如果是独立窗口就没问题

谢谢大家!
图片点击可在新窗口打开查看此主题相关图片如下:列名不见了.png
图片点击可在新窗口打开查看

--  作者:大红袍
--  发布时间:2016/3/28 22:15:00
--  

窗口的afterLoad事件,设置定位到第一行试试

 

e.Form.Controls("Table1").Table.Select(0, 0)


--  作者:四月清风
--  发布时间:2016/3/29 9:38:00
--  
试了,没有作用呢,感觉这个表是被菜单挡在下面了
e.Form.Controls("Table1").Table.Select(0, 0)
这个代码无法起作用,感觉是可以移到0,0的,只是被挡在下面,看不到了,

我这个是外部表,
我重新增加了一个外部表“订单流水_"显示则是正常的。
我可不可以把”订单流水“删除,然后把”订单流水_"改为“订单流水”,这样子处理的话,会不会丢失什么数据呢?或者关于代码,表关联方面要注意的?



--  作者:大红袍
--  发布时间:2016/3/29 10:08:00
--  

你可以删除表,重新建立,当然代码关联什么的你要重新设置。

 

或者把项目发上来看看。

 

 


--  作者:四月清风
--  发布时间:2016/3/29 12:43:00
--  
我再试一下,不行再上传.
发现有另外一个问题,我是连接外部数据源,后来增加了5列表达式列,但我在SQL数据库里面并没有找到这5列,这5列是存在哪里的呢?是内部数据源吗?
这样子是不是有什么隐患呢?我该如何统一存放到SQL数据库?

--  作者:四月清风
--  发布时间:2016/3/29 13:58:00
--  
截图
图片点击可在新窗口打开查看此主题相关图片如下:sql列.png
图片点击可在新窗口打开查看
图片点击可在新窗口打开查看此主题相关图片如下:fox-旧表.png
图片点击可在新窗口打开查看


--  作者:大红袍
--  发布时间:2016/3/29 14:22:00
--  

 表达式列,是否foxtable动态创建的,不会保存在数据库里面,而且没必要保存在数据库里。

 

 如果要保存到数据库,那就不能用表达式列,改成数据列,然后用代码计算

 

http://www.foxtable.com/help/topics/1469.htm

 


--  作者:四月清风
--  发布时间:2016/3/29 15:43:00
--  
嗯,理解了,我把项目和数据库都备份,重新制作,现在问题已经解决了,
以后还是要多弄几个备份